LXer: How to Disable the Touchpad When a Mouse Is Connected in Linux GNOME Shell


Published at LXer:

Gnome Shell has an option to disable the touchpad, but you can bring it further to get it to automatically disable the touchpad when a mouse is connected. Find out how here.
